#a6e196 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a6e196 is composed of 65.1% red, 88.2%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.3%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 107.2 degrees, a saturation of 55.6% and a lightness of 73.5%. #a6e196 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4dc32d.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

#a6e196 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a6e196 has RGB values of R:166, G:225,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0, Y:0.33,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 10936726.

Shades and Tints of #a6e196
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f4fbf2 is the lightest one.
